Lego Constructs Life-Size Drivable McLaren P1 with 343000 Technic Pieces Reaching 40mph

Lego and McLaren have taken their collaboration to extraordinary new heights. Their latest feat is a life-size, drivable McLaren P1 made from 342,817 Lego Technic pieces.

This remarkable creation is not just a model but a functioning vehicle, powered by 768 Lego motors and capable of reaching speeds up to 40mph. This article delves into the intricate details of this engineering marvel.

Unprecedented Collaboration and Engineering

Lego and McLaren have a long-standing relationship, marked by several incredible projects, including scaled replicas of iconic racing cars. However, this life-size McLaren P1 surpasses all previous endeavors. Utilizing precisely 342,817 Lego Technic pieces, the project is an engineering marvel. The team incorporated both Technic batteries and a small EV battery to power the vehicle, demonstrating a seamless blend of creativity and technology.

The Intricacies of Building the P1

Crafting this life-sized vehicle was no small feat. It required the dedication of 23 specialists from both Lego and McLaren. Over 8,344 hours were invested in the assembly, showcasing the meticulous planning and execution required for such a complex project. The use of eight motor packs, each containing 96 Lego Power function motors, highlights the innovative approach taken by the engineers.

Performance and Testing

Remarkably, the vehicle weighs 1,220kg, just 200kg lighter than an actual McLaren P1 equipped with a twin-turbocharged V8 and hybrid system. This weight comparison underscores the robustness of the Lego construction, despite being primarily composed of plastic bricks.

Public Reception and Future Prospects

While there is no word yet on whether instructions for the 1:1 scale model will be released, the prospect itself has generated considerable interest. It’s viewed as an unattainable dream for many Lego enthusiasts, but one that inspires creativity and determination.
